Hiring new tech talent in the government

Kimberly Holden, deputy associate director of Talent Acquisition, Classification and Veterans programs at the Office of Personnel Management, discusses the ways OPM is trying to attract people in the tech industry to apply for government jobs.

Russia violates nuclear treaty

Lynn Rusten, vice president of the Global Nuclear Policy Program at the Nuclear Threat Initiative, discusses Russia’s refusal to allow the U.S. to conduct an inspection of its nuclear facilities.

Enforcing antitrust laws on tech companies

Diana Moss, president of the American Antitrust Institute, discusses antitrust enforcement on tech companies.
